Detective Comics #626 (1991) comic value
An ungraded copy of Detective Comics #626 (1991) averages around $4. A CGC 6.0 runs about $10, and a CGC 8.0 commands $13.
What drives the price
Grade is everything in comics — spine ticks, page color, and restoration decide the number, and the jump from raw to high grade can be 10×+. Key issues (first appearances, origins, deaths) carry the biggest premiums, and early printings beat reprints.
